GeocodingLevel Enumeration

Indicates the maximum geocoding level in the hierarchical order (from street level matching to country level matching) for the points of interest data uploaded for geocoding on the MapPoint servers.

Members

Name Description
City Indicates that the city level geocoding is allowed. If this geocoding level is selected, all ambiguous addresses at street and postal code levels are geocoded against their city names.
CountryRegion Indicates that the country/region level geocoding is allowed. If this geocoding level is selected, all ambiguous addresses at street, postal code and city levels are geocoded against their country names.
PostalCode Indicates that the postal code level geocoding is allowed. If this geocoding level is selected, all ambiguous addresses at street level are geocoded against their postal codes.
Street Indicates that the points of interest data will be geocoded at the street name (and number) level. When an ambiguious address is found with this geocoding level, that record will not be marked as ambiguious and will not be geocoded at other levels such as postal code or city and so on.
Subdivision Indicates that the subdivision/state level geocoding is allowed. If this geocoding level is selected, all ambiguous addresses at street, postal code and city levels are geocoded against their state/subdivison.

Example

 
[Visual Basic]

'This example assumes that the customer data service namespace 
'has been imported 

'Create an instance of the customer data service proxy.
Dim custDataService As CustomerDataService = New CustomerDataService
'Assign your credentials.
custDataService.Credentials = _
        New NetworkCredential(myUserName, mySecurePassword, myDomainName)

'Set PreAuthenticate to True
custDataService.PreAuthenticate = True

Try
    'Define an upload specification object
    'and assign all required fields.
    Dim uploadSpec As UploadSpecification = New UploadSpecification
    uploadSpec.DataSourceName = myDataSourceName
    uploadSpec.EntityTypeName = myEntityTypeName
    uploadSpec.Environment = LocationDataEnvironment.Staging
    uploadSpec.MaximumGeocodingLevel = GeocodingLevel.City
    uploadSpec.RejectAmbiguousGeocodes = False
    'Start an upload job and obtain the job ID.
    Dim jobID As String = custDataService.StartUpload(uploadSpec)
Catch e As Exception
    Dim message As String = e.Message
    'Do your exception handling here.
End Try
